Cost Details, Estimates, and Budget Tips
Before finalizing your charter, you need to understand what affects local charter costs - including vehicle size, mileage, length of service, peak vs off-peak timing, and additional fees like tolls or parking. Get itemized pricing from several services using identical trip details for accurate comparison. To save money, look into choosing non-peak periods, optimizing group size, reducing downtime, and making early arrangements.
Elements That Determine Charter Rates
Although transportation costs may look variable at first look, they are determined by key components: coach style and passenger capacity, trip length and distance, scheduling and high-demand times, pickup and delivery points, bus amenities, and necessary permits and parking requirements. Prices fluctuate with seasonal demand-spring break activities, special events, and sporting events affect availability. Extended journeys with complicated paths, several destinations, or rigid timetables raise overall costs. Operator experience matters significantly; seasoned professionals earn premium wages but improve reliability and efficiency. Venues in central areas or waterfront spots may demand additional permits and paid waiting zones, impacting total cost. Consider parking restrictions at cruise ports and stadiums. Premium features-internet access, charging ports, bathroom access, premium seating-increase rates. Lastly, one-way return trips can significantly impact your final price.
Requesting Quote Information
Start by determining the fundamental trip elements-headcount, dates, pickup/drop-off points, itinerary, and must-have amenities-then request detailed quotes from a minimum of three Tampa companies. Provide accurate group size, pickup details, luggage specifications, accessibility needs, and if you require driver accommodation. Clarify hourly versus daily rates, minimums, deadhead miles, tolls, parking, and overtime. Obtain itemized costs: base rate, fuel, taxes, fees, gratuity, and cancellation policy. Submit a preliminary schedule with precise times and addresses so vendors can accurately price wait time and mileage.
Review the age of equipment, seating options, Wi‑Fi availability, power connections, and bathroom access as well as price points. Validate liability coverage amounts, DOT compliance records, and backup vehicle arrangements. Obtain a written hold period and payment timeline. When pricing details seem unclear, seek additional details prior to confirming.
Ways to Save Money
The biggest savings on Tampa charter buses typically come from smart planning and strategic choices. Book in advance to secure lower rates, then get multiple quotes with identical journey details. Opt for midweek travel or off-season periods when rates decrease with reduced demand. Choose the right-sized bus to eliminate excess capacity costs. Lower costs by streamlining pickup spots and organizing optimized travel schedules to decrease overall transportation costs.
Take advantage of group discounts by bundling multiple journeys or round-trips. Ask about Corporate partnerships if you're booking regular events; negotiated rates outperform one-offs. Cut costs by sharing expenses among travelers or matching like-minded parties. Opt for a unified pickup spot and prevent overtime by confirming driver shift limits. Carry your own water and snacks to avoid add-on fees. In conclusion, confirm all charges-tolls, parking, sanitation-before finalizing.
Your Guide to Booking and Trip Day Preparation
Before finalizing your vehicle selection, carefully plan your passenger count, schedule, and required features to get a precise estimate and suitable bus. Prepare a comprehensive list of: dates and times, collection and return locations, total headcount, special needs accommodations, baggage space needs, vehicle features (wireless connection, electrical outlets, lavatory), and chauffeur requirements. Request a detailed contract, payment timeline, and cancellation guidelines. Establish a communication chain and same-day contact protocol.
One week before the trip, confirm the schedule and locations. The evening before, go through your departure checklist: travel route, staging locations, passenger roster, seating or rooming notes, special equipment, and payment receipts. On trip day, be there 15 minutes ahead, connect with your chauffeur, review the route, and pack systematically. Monitor timing, communicate changes promptly, and record problems for swift resolution.

What Rules and Regulations Cover Service Animals and Emotional Support Animals
Service animals are welcome as operators are required to allow them with full public access requiring minimal paperwork - typically just verification of specific task training. For emotional support animals, policies differ and might need preliminary approval, transport operator discretion, and containment requirements. You must maintain proper control, hygiene, and damage responsibility. Be sure to give advance notice to the operator, communicate seating preferences, and review written policies so staff can prepare necessary arrangements and prevent boarding delays.
